    Review: DPx HEST/Folding Blade Triple Black Serrated



    Reason for Purchase
    After I finished carrying the BENCHMADE 5000SBK AUTO PRESIDIO, a little over two years ago, I decided that I would get a different blade, something non-automatic, to carry EDC. Ever since then I have been carrying the HEST/F blade everyday as a utility, general purpose blade. Three main selling points over the Presidio, first the HEST/F is not auto, so I can carrying in states I could not carry the Presidio. The HEST/F has a D2 steel blade over the 154CM blade of the Presidio and the fact you can lock the HEST/F into the fixed position by the turn of a knob.

    Used the wire stripper function today in fact! Wanted to use the bottle opener but had to head in to work instead. Bummer.

    But yeah. Really like the deep pocket carry clip. Wave functionality is good, although still new and a bit stiff. The glass break point on the end really isn't a detriment to edc like I feared. Solidly built.

    Seems like a winner so far.
